INTERNAL MEMO — Reseller Programme Update

To: Branch Managers

The Tarnwick Partner Programme opens for enrolment next month. Resellers meeting the silver tier threshold receive 18% margin on the Loomis suite and access to co-branded marketing materials. Branch managers should identify two candidate resellers per territory and submit nominations by the 15th. Training sessions run weekly from the Halden office. Onboarding targets are tied to next quarter's plan.

confidential, tagag-kahof: Rusathox Partners plans to lower the Gorox list price by 63 percent in December.

Subject: SQL lint cut-over — done

Hello, and welcome to the team. Over the weekend we completed the cut-over to Querygate, our new linter for SQL files. All pull requests now run Querygate checks automatically, and the old ad-hoc style script has been retired. Please review any open branches carefully, since previously tolerated formatting will now fail CI. The linter runs with the configuration values shown below.

deployment values, hahaf-fahop:
zorwyn:
  log_level: debug
  metrics_host: metrics.zorwyn.tolvaqlabs.internal
  pool_size: 8

# Lease Renegotiation — Tillbrook Campus (Managers Only)

Welcome aboard. Quick context: our lease on the Tillbrook campus expires next autumn, and we've opened renegotiation with the landlord, Quarrow Estates. We're pushing for a shorter term and a break clause, trading off a modest rent uplift. Facilities has the redline drafts; legal review wraps this month. Don't discuss terms outside this group. The confidential strategic angle is summarised right below.

confidential, fajop-fajef: Soriusax Foods plans to lower the Rusix list price by 43.2 percent in December. The steering committee signed off on a budget of $74.0 million for Project Oliion. The renewal with Brivanix Works closes at $118.6 million a year, 43.4 percent above the last contract. Project Ulaiel slips by six weeks because of the audit delay.

## Nightly Search Reindex — Who to Ping

Welcome! The nightly reindex for Quillhopper Search kicks off around 02:15 and usually wraps by 04:00. If it stalls, check the Fernbrook dashboard first — nine times out of ten it's a stuck shard on the Tindle cluster. Don't restart anything yourself on your first week; the Indexing Guild owns this job and they're friendly about questions. Marla Voss is the current rotation lead. For anything reindex-related, just drop a note to the team inbox below.

alerts address for yajof-kahog: eliax@qirvanlabs.corp